116 /* SHA256 by Tom St Denis */
117 
118 /* Various logical functions */
119 #define ROR(x, y)\
120 ( ((((unsigned long)(x)&0xFFFFFFFFUL)>>(unsigned long)((y)&31)) | \
121 ((unsigned long)(x)<<(unsigned long)(32-((y)&31)))) & 0xFFFFFFFFUL)
122 #define Ch(x,y,z)       (z ^ (x & (y ^ z)))
123 #define Maj(x,y,z)      (((x | y) & z) | (x & y))
124 #define S(x, n)         ROR((x),(n))
125 #define R(x, n)         (((x)&0xFFFFFFFFUL)>>(n))
126 #define Sigma0(x)       (S(x, 2) ^ S(x, 13) ^ S(x, 22))
127 #define Sigma1(x)       (S(x, 6) ^ S(x, 11) ^ S(x, 25))
128 #define Gamma0(x)       (S(x, 7) ^ S(x, 18) ^ R(x, 3))
129 #define Gamma1(x)       (S(x, 17) ^ S(x, 19) ^ R(x, 10))
130 
131 
132 static void
sha_transform(SHAobject * sha_info)133 sha_transform(SHAobject *sha_info)
134 {
135     int i;
136         SHA_INT32 S[8], W[64], t0, t1;
137 
138     memcpy(W, sha_info->data, sizeof(sha_info->data));
139 #if PY_LITTLE_ENDIAN
140     longReverse(W, (int)sizeof(sha_info->data));
141 #endif
142 
143     for (i = 16; i < 64; ++i) {
144                 W[i] = Gamma1(W[i - 2]) + W[i - 7] + Gamma0(W[i - 15]) + W[i - 16];
145     }
146     for (i = 0; i < 8; ++i) {
147         S[i] = sha_info->digest[i];
148     }
149 
150     /* Compress */
151 #define RND(a,b,c,d,e,f,g,h,i,ki)                    \
152      t0 = h + Sigma1(e) + Ch(e, f, g) + ki + W[i];   \
153      t1 = Sigma0(a) + Maj(a, b, c);                  \
154      d += t0;                                        \
155      h  = t0 + t1;
156 
157     RND(S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],0,0x428a2f98);
158     RND(S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],1,0x71374491);
159     RND(S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],2,0xb5c0fbcf);
160     RND(S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],3,0xe9b5dba5);
161     RND(S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],4,0x3956c25b);
162     RND(S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],5,0x59f111f1);
163     RND(S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],6,0x923f82a4);
164     RND(S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],7,0xab1c5ed5);
165     RND(S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],8,0xd807aa98);
166     RND(S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],9,0x12835b01);
167     RND(S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],10,0x243185be);
168     RND(S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],11,0x550c7dc3);
169     RND(S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],12,0x72be5d74);
170     RND(S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],13,0x80deb1fe);
171     RND(S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],14,0x9bdc06a7);
172     RND(S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],15,0xc19bf174);
173     RND(S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],16,0xe49b69c1);
174     RND(S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],17,0xefbe4786);
175     RND(S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],18,0x0fc19dc6);
176     RND(S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],19,0x240ca1cc);
177     RND(S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],20,0x2de92c6f);
178     RND(S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],21,0x4a7484aa);
179     RND(S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],22,0x5cb0a9dc);
180     RND(S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],23,0x76f988da);
181     RND(S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],24,0x983e5152);
182     RND(S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],25,0xa831c66d);
183     RND(S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],26,0xb00327c8);
184     RND(S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],27,0xbf597fc7);
185     RND(S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],28,0xc6e00bf3);
186     RND(S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],29,0xd5a79147);
187     RND(S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],30,0x06ca6351);
188     RND(S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],31,0x14292967);
189     RND(S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],32,0x27b70a85);
190     RND(S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],33,0x2e1b2138);
191     RND(S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],34,0x4d2c6dfc);
192     RND(S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],35,0x53380d13);
193     RND(S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],36,0x650a7354);
194     RND(S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],37,0x766a0abb);
195     RND(S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],38,0x81c2c92e);
196     RND(S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],39,0x92722c85);
197     RND(S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],40,0xa2bfe8a1);
198     RND(S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],41,0xa81a664b);
199     RND(S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],42,0xc24b8b70);
200     RND(S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],43,0xc76c51a3);
201     RND(S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],44,0xd192e819);
202     RND(S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],45,0xd6990624);
203     RND(S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],46,0xf40e3585);
204     RND(S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],47,0x106aa070);
205     RND(S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],48,0x19a4c116);
206     RND(S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],49,0x1e376c08);
207     RND(S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],50,0x2748774c);
208     RND(S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],51,0x34b0bcb5);
209     RND(S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],52,0x391c0cb3);
210     RND(S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],53,0x4ed8aa4a);
211     RND(S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],54,0x5b9cca4f);
212     RND(S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],55,0x682e6ff3);
213     RND(S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],56,0x748f82ee);
214     RND(S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],57,0x78a5636f);
215     RND(S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],58,0x84c87814);
216     RND(S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],59,0x8cc70208);
217     RND(S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],S[3],60,0x90befffa);
218     RND(S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],S[2],61,0xa4506ceb);
219     RND(S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],S[1],62,0xbef9a3f7);
220     RND(S[1],S[2],S[3],S[4],S[5],S[6],S[7],S[0],63,0xc67178f2);
221 
222 #undef RND
223 
224     /* feedback */
225     for (i = 0; i < 8; i++) {
226         sha_info->digest[i] = sha_info->digest[i] + S[i];
227     }
228 
229 }
230 
231 
232 
233 /* initialize the SHA digest */
234 
235 static void
sha_init(SHAobject * sha_info)236 sha_init(SHAobject *sha_info)
237 {
238     sha_info->digest[0] = 0x6A09E667L;
239     sha_info->digest[1] = 0xBB67AE85L;
240     sha_info->digest[2] = 0x3C6EF372L;
241     sha_info->digest[3] = 0xA54FF53AL;
242     sha_info->digest[4] = 0x510E527FL;
243     sha_info->digest[5] = 0x9B05688CL;
244     sha_info->digest[6] = 0x1F83D9ABL;
245     sha_info->digest[7] = 0x5BE0CD19L;
246     sha_info->count_lo = 0L;
247     sha_info->count_hi = 0L;
248     sha_info->local = 0;
249     sha_info->digestsize = 32;
250 }
251 
252 static void
sha224_init(SHAobject * sha_info)253 sha224_init(SHAobject *sha_info)
254 {
255     sha_info->digest[0] = 0xc1059ed8L;
256     sha_info->digest[1] = 0x367cd507L;
257     sha_info->digest[2] = 0x3070dd17L;
258     sha_info->digest[3] = 0xf70e5939L;
259     sha_info->digest[4] = 0xffc00b31L;
260     sha_info->digest[5] = 0x68581511L;
261     sha_info->digest[6] = 0x64f98fa7L;
262     sha_info->digest[7] = 0xbefa4fa4L;
263     sha_info->count_lo = 0L;
264     sha_info->count_hi = 0L;
265     sha_info->local = 0;
266     sha_info->digestsize = 28;
267 }
268 
269 
270 /* update the SHA digest */
271 
272 static void
sha_update(SHAobject * sha_info,SHA_BYTE * buffer,Py_ssize_t count)273 sha_update(SHAobject *sha_info, SHA_BYTE *buffer, Py_ssize_t count)
274 {
275     Py_ssize_t i;
276     SHA_INT32 clo;
277 
278     clo = sha_info->count_lo + ((SHA_INT32) count << 3);
279     if (clo < sha_info->count_lo) {
280         ++sha_info->count_hi;
281     }
282     sha_info->count_lo = clo;
283     sha_info->count_hi += (SHA_INT32) count >> 29;
284     if (sha_info->local) {
285         i = SHA_BLOCKSIZE - sha_info->local;
286         if (i > count) {
287             i = count;
288         }
289         memcpy(((SHA_BYTE *) sha_info->data) + sha_info->local, buffer, i);
290         count -= i;
291         buffer += i;
292         sha_info->local += (int)i;
293         if (sha_info->local == SHA_BLOCKSIZE) {
294             sha_transform(sha_info);
295         }
296         else {
297             return;
298         }
299     }
300     while (count >= SHA_BLOCKSIZE) {
301         memcpy(sha_info->data, buffer, SHA_BLOCKSIZE);
302         buffer += SHA_BLOCKSIZE;
303         count -= SHA_BLOCKSIZE;
304         sha_transform(sha_info);
305     }
306     memcpy(sha_info->data, buffer, count);
307     sha_info->local = (int)count;
308 }
309 
310 /* finish computing the SHA digest */
311 
312 static void
sha_final(unsigned char digest[SHA_DIGESTSIZE],SHAobject * sha_info)313 sha_final(unsigned char digest[SHA_DIGESTSIZE], SHAobject *sha_info)
314 {
315     int count;
316     SHA_INT32 lo_bit_count, hi_bit_count;
317 
318     lo_bit_count = sha_info->count_lo;
319     hi_bit_count = sha_info->count_hi;
320     count = (int) ((lo_bit_count >> 3) & 0x3f);
321     ((SHA_BYTE *) sha_info->data)[count++] = 0x80;
322     if (count > SHA_BLOCKSIZE - 8) {
323         memset(((SHA_BYTE *) sha_info->data) + count, 0,
324                SHA_BLOCKSIZE - count);
325         sha_transform(sha_info);
326         memset((SHA_BYTE *) sha_info->data, 0, SHA_BLOCKSIZE - 8);
327     }
328     else {
329         memset(((SHA_BYTE *) sha_info->data) + count, 0,
330                SHA_BLOCKSIZE - 8 - count);
331     }
332 
333     /* GJS: note that we add the hi/lo in big-endian. sha_transform will
334        swap these values into host-order. */
335     sha_info->data[56] = (hi_bit_count >> 24) & 0xff;
336     sha_info->data[57] = (hi_bit_count >> 16) & 0xff;
337     sha_info->data[58] = (hi_bit_count >>  8) & 0xff;
338     sha_info->data[59] = (hi_bit_count >>  0) & 0xff;
339     sha_info->data[60] = (lo_bit_count >> 24) & 0xff;
340     sha_info->data[61] = (lo_bit_count >> 16) & 0xff;
341     sha_info->data[62] = (lo_bit_count >>  8) & 0xff;
342     sha_info->data[63] = (lo_bit_count >>  0) & 0xff;
343     sha_transform(sha_info);
344     digest[ 0]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[0] >> 24) & 0xff);
345     digest[ 1]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[0] >> 16) & 0xff);
346     digest[ 2]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[0] >>  8) & 0xff);
347     digest[ 3]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[0]      ) & 0xff);
348     digest[ 4]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[1] >> 24) & 0xff);
349     digest[ 5]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[1] >> 16) & 0xff);
350     digest[ 6]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[1] >>  8) & 0xff);
351     digest[ 7]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[1]      ) & 0xff);
352     digest[ 8]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[2] >> 24) & 0xff);
353     digest[ 9]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[2] >> 16) & 0xff);
354     digest[10]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[2] >>  8) & 0xff);
355     digest[11]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[2]      ) & 0xff);
356     digest[12]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[3] >> 24) & 0xff);
357     digest[13]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[3] >> 16) & 0xff);
358     digest[14]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[3] >>  8) & 0xff);
359     digest[15]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[3]      ) & 0xff);
360     digest[16]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[4] >> 24) & 0xff);
361     digest[17]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[4] >> 16) & 0xff);
362     digest[18]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[4] >>  8) & 0xff);
363     digest[19]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[4]      ) & 0xff);
364     digest[20]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[5] >> 24) & 0xff);
365     digest[21]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[5] >> 16) & 0xff);
366     digest[22]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[5] >>  8) & 0xff);
367     digest[23]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[5]      ) & 0xff);
368     digest[24]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[6] >> 24) & 0xff);
369     digest[25]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[6] >> 16) & 0xff);
370     digest[26]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[6] >>  8) & 0xff);
371     digest[27]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[6]      ) & 0xff);
372     digest[28]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[7] >> 24) & 0xff);
373     digest[29]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[7] >> 16) & 0xff);
374     digest[30]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[7] >>  8) & 0xff);
375     digest[31] = (unsigned char) ((sha_info->digest[7]      ) & 0xff);
376 }
